RS
RSSI (Receive Signal Strength Indicator) Returns the
signal level of last received packet. This is DAC reading of
the RSSI in the radio. It is not calibrated, but gives a relative
signal strength indication.
No parameters. Returns a
number 0-1024.
none
SL
Serial Number Reads and returns a unique serial number
for thjs unit.
Read Only
1 - 999999999
unique
SH
Show Display the configuration of the modem. This will
return a page of ASCII characters, showing the main
configuration parameters.
none
None
SV
Save Save all the parameters to EEPROM. This command
must be used if changed parameters are to be stored in non-
volatile memory, and used next time the modem is powered
up. Modem exits configuration mode after this command is
executed. It saves all parameters except the frequency (The
frequency is automatically saved when an ATFT, ATFR, or
ATFX command is executed)
none
None
TD
Transmit Random Data For test purposes only. When
issued, the modem will begin sending random data. Entering
a <CR> will terminate the transmission. There is a 60-second
time-out-timer.

TT
Max Packet Size Set the maximum number of bytes in an
over-the-air packet.
1 - 512
240
VB
Read DC input Voltage Returns the DC input voltage
reading, in mV (12500 = 12.5VDC input).
None
none
VR
Firmware Version Returns firmware version currently
loaded into the unit.
Read Only, 3
characters
none
&F
Restore Factory Restore the factory default values. This
command will not erase the calibration values. After this
command executes, the modem will still be in the CONFIG
mode.
